Cost of Sidewalk Curb Cutting in Windsor

The cost of sidewalk curb cutting in Windsor, CO can vary significantly based on various factors. Whether you are a homeowner looking to improve accessibility or a business owner ensuring compliance with local regulations, understanding these costs is crucial for budgeting and planning purposes.

Factors Affecting Cost

  • Project Size: Larger projects typically cost more due to the increased amount of labor and materials required.
  • Material Types: The type of materials used can affect the overall cost, with concrete being more expensive than asphalt.
  •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Windsor, CO can influence the total expense, as skilled labor is often required for curb cutting.
  • Permits and Regulations: Compliance with local regulations and obtaining necessary permits can add to the cost.
  • Accessibility: The ease of access to the work site can impact labor time and equipment usage, thus affecting the cost.
  • Equipment Needs: Specialized equipment may be required for certain types of curb cuts, increasing the project cost.
  • Disposal Fees: The cost of disposing of old materials can add to the overall expense.

Average Costs for Common Tasks

Task Average Cost (USD)
Standard Curb Cut $30 - $50 per linear foot
ADA-Compliant Curb Ramp $1,200 - $1,500 per ramp
Permits and Inspections $100 - $300
Concrete Removal and Disposal $200 - $400
Site Preparation $100 - $200
Traffic Control Measures $50 - $150 per hour
